sure, with Tarver-Hopkins you're getting:Originally posted by GodzHandAnyone know what it is?
Antonio Tarver vs. Bernard Hopkins, light heavyweights
Co-feature: Israel Vazquez vs. Ivan Hernandez for Vazquez' WBC super bantamweight title
Special attraction: Hector Camacho, Jr. vs. Andrey Tsurkan for the vacant NABF junior middleweight title
Undercard: Jorge Paez, Jr. vs. Travis Hartman, junior welterweights
whereas, if you get Cotto-Paulie you're getting:
Miguel Angel Cotto vs. Paul Malignaggi for Cotto's WBO junior welterweight title
John Duddy vs. Alfredo Cuevas for Duddy's WBC continental americas middleweight title
Undercard: Bobby Pacquiao vs. Kevin Kelley, super featherweights
Julio Cesar Chavez, Jr. vs. Aaron Drake, junior welterweights
Juan Manuel Lopez vs. Sergio Mendez, featherweights
Special attraction: pro debut of Notre Dame football player Tom Zbikowski vs. Robert Bell, heavyweights
it's a no-brainer which one to spend $$$ on if you're only buying one, Cotto-Malignaggi... but that's just my opinion.Comment
